Summary

The Lightbend and Datadog teams have announced an official integration for Akka, a key component of the Lightbend Reactive Platform. This integration allows users building Akka-based Reactive applications to gain real-time insights into their application's health, availability, and performance with Datadog. The integration uses Lightbend Monitoring, which includes metrics/telemetry modules that report metrics to Datadog, covering aspects such as actor mailbox size, processing time for messages, and serialization times for remote messages. With this integration, users can set up their application with the Datadog instrumentation plugin, configure Akka telemetry, and access a predefined dashboard to monitor their Reactive applications. The Lightbend and Datadog teams will continue to enhance this integration, adding more metrics and features to be reflected in the Datadog dashboards.
